The Physical Benefits
Racquetball is an excellent way for young athletes to improve their overall fitness. The game's fast pace demands quick reflexes, agility, and endurance. As juniors engage in regular play, they enhance their cardiovascular health, muscle strength, and coordination. In an age where childhood obesity rates are concerning, racquetball offers an engaging alternative to sedentary activities like video gaming and excessive screen time.
Moreover, racquetball provides a full-body workout. Players use their arms, legs, and core muscles, developing strength and flexibility while having fun. Unlike more traditional team sports, racquetball can be played as a solo sport or in pairs, allowing juniors to compete at their comfort level while still honing their skills. This versatility can lead to a longer-lasting love for the sport, keeping young athletes active for years to come.
The Mental Advantages
Beyond the physical perks, racquetball fosters cognitive development in juniors. The game requires strategic thinking, quick decision-making, and spatial awareness. Players must constantly analyze their opponent's movements, anticipate their next move, and devise a counterstrategy—all of which sharpen mental acuity. These skills can transfer positively to academic performance, as young players learn to focus and think critically under pressure.
Additionally, the nature of racquetball encourages resilience. Losing a match can be frustrating, but it also presents an opportunity for juniors to learn from their mistakes and improve. The ability to handle defeat gracefully is a vital life lesson that extends far beyond the court. This mental fortitude is invaluable as juniors face various challenges throughout their lives.
The Social Aspect
Participating in junior racquetball also nurtures important social skills. In a world that is becoming increasingly disconnected, racquetball provides a platform for young athletes to develop friendships and camaraderie. Whether playing in pairs or as part of a larger league, juniors learn teamwork, sportsmanship, and communication. They experience firsthand the joy of both winning and losing with grace, fostering emotional intelligence and empathy.
Racquetball programs often emphasize inclusivity, allowing players of all skill levels to participate. This diversity creates an environment where juniors can form bonds with peers they might not have met otherwise. These connections can lead to lasting friendships and a sense of community, enhancing the overall experience of the sport.
